What is it Toyota Corolla Cross 1.8 Dynamic?

Toyota Corolla Cross Dynamic with 1.8 is a version of the popular SUV that Toyota has been offering for some time now. It is the second cheapest version of the non-business models. It is also a simple looking car that still clearly shows that it is a Toyota. The car has a friendly appearance, it looks like a car that you can get in and out of, for example, traveling to Algeria with your whole family and your cat without any worries.

This is the first from Toyota with the fifth generation hybrid powertrain. This is one of the powertrains coming in the new CH-R. This car was only available with 197 hp, but now there is a 1.8 version with 140 hp, which, according to Toyota, will be a sales hit in the Netherlands. That’s the version we drove in this test drive. A test drive of the more expensive Launch Edition 2.0 can be found here.

We drove a Toyota Corolla Cross 1.8 Dynamic. Power is, as I just wrote, the second cheapest version of non-commercial models. The 1800cc four-cylinder is mated to a continuously variable transmission (CVT) and, surprisingly, is almost as economical as the 2.0 (5 liters per 100km, the 2.0 doesn’t have 5.1 per 100km). Weak points

The gearbox of the Toyota Corolla Cross of course has P, R, N, D and B. That B, like most cars, is the way to restore the brakes. In that case, the car puts more brakes on the battery so it can charge faster. We always enjoy driving this car. Unfortunately, you can’t activate the cruise control in B mode. To do that, you have to ‘shift’ to D to drive on the highway. That’s crazy and annoying.

Equipment

Our test model is nice and basic. No electric seats, no leather, no heated seats. All right. What is usually included is as follows:

  • Privacy glass behind
  • Get in and drive without the key
  • Dual Zone Climate Control
  • Navigation on the 10.5-inch screen
  • 12.3 inch digital instruments
  • Entrance lighting and storage cupboards feature in the interior
  • The interior mirror automatically dims
  • Rear camera
  • Adaptive Cruise Control (with almost all known and modern safety systems)

Toyota Corolla Cross in the basic version is is available from EUR 38,195 (in Belgium from EUR 34,880). Our test model is the closest affordable version in the range, the Dynamic. With all options (unity) added, we arrive at approximately EUR 40,545.
